Herb-Roasted Turkey Breast

Nutrition Information

Serving size –4 ounces

Calories – 190

Calories from fat – 20

Total fat – 2.2 grams

Saturated fat – 0.5 grams

Cholesterol – 94 mg

Sodium – 60 mg

Total carbohydrates – 0 grams

Protein – 35 grams

Tips

  1. Try using chicken
  2. Use your own herb combination
  3. Use dripping to make your gravy
  4. Replace rosemary, sage, thyme & black pepper with poultry seasoning

Serving: 6

Prep time: 25 minutes

Cook time: 2 hours

Ingredients

1 whole bone-in turkey breast, 6.5 to 7 pounds

1 tablespoon minced garlic (3 cloves)

2-teaspoon dry mustard

1-tablespoon rosemary leaves

1-tablespoon sage leaves

1-teaspoon thyme

1-teaspoon black pepper

1-tablespoon olive oil

2 tablespoons lemon juice

1-cup dry white wine

Directions

  1. Preheat oven to 325 degrees
  2. Place turkey breast, skin side up, on a rack in a roasting pan
  3. In a small bowl, combine garlic, mustard, herbs, pepper, olive oil and lemon juice to make a paste
  4. Smear the paste over the meat; pour wine into the bottom of the pan
  5. Roast the turkey for 1 hour 45 minutes to 2 hours until the skin is golden brown and an inserted thermometer reads 165 degrees. 
  6. Remove from oven; discard the skin.
  7. Cover with foil and allow to rest for 10-15 minutes.  Slice and serve.
